Output 50b8b1d75156bc4dc00c33ac38274a4fa3b4e1dfa8ee93f1ca3fb0ef86406273:1

value
1354693
script pubkey
OP_0 OP_PUSHBYTES_20 ff12be255af197519181d40aace5e9efaaad08b0
address
bc1qluftuf267xt4ryvp6s92ee0fa7426z9skr3mv6
transaction
50b8b1d75156bc4dc00c33ac38274a4fa3b4e1dfa8ee93f1ca3fb0ef86406273
spent
true